书目名称 | State-Society Relations and Confucian Revivalism in Contemporary China | 编辑 | Qin Pang | 视频video | | 概述 | Seeks to analyze the rise of neo-confucian values in China.Describes the rise of civil society in post-reform China.Explores how Confucian values play out in governmentality and business in contempora | 图书封面 |  | 描述 | This book is a study of the causes of the Confucian revival and the party-state’s response in China today. It concentrates on the interactions between state and society, and the implications for the Chinese state’s control over society, or in other words, its survival over a rapidly modernizing society. The book explores the answers to questions such as: Why has Confucianism suddenly gathered great momentum in contemporary Chinese society? What is the role of the Chinese state in its rise? Is the state really the orchestrator of the Confucian revival as has been widely assumed?
